Structural foundation repair services focus on diagnosing and addressing issues related to the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ically involve thorough inspections to identify signs of settlement, cracking, or shifting, followed by targeted repair methods to restore stability. Techniques may include underpinning, slabjacking, pier installation, or the reinforcement of existing foundation elements. The goal is to prevent further damage, improve safety, and ensure the long-term durability of the property.
Foundation problems can lead to a range of structural concerns, including u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the foundation itself. If left unaddressed, these issues can worsen over time, potentially resulting in significant damage to the property’s structure and interior. Structural foundation repair services help resolve these problems by stabilizing the foundation and correcting any underlying causes, thereby reducing the risk of more extensive and costly repairs in the future.

Foundation Repair Cost - The typical cost for foundation repair services ranges from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of the damage. Minor repairs may be closer to the lower end, while more extensive work can approach the higher end of the spectrum.
Pier and Beam Repairs - Repair costs for pier and beam foundations generally fall between $1,500 and $5,000. Factors influencing price include the size of the structure and the severity of the issues present.
Concrete Slab Repair - The average expense for repairing concrete slabs ranges from $1,000 to $4,000. Larger or more complex slab issues tend to increase the overall cost of repair services.
Cost Factors - Overall costs can vary based on the foundation’s location, accessibility, and the extent of structural damage. Local pros can provide detailed estimates tailored to specific repair needs in Mundelein, IL, and nearby areas.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ation problems? Signs include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around door frames.
How long does foundation repair typ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the repair, but most projects can range from a few days to several weeks.
Are foundation repairs necessary for minor cracks? Minor cracks may not require immediate repair, but it is advisable to have a professional assessment to determine if intervention is needed.
What types of foundation repair methods are available? Common methods include underpinning, pier and beam repair, slab jacking, and wall stabilization, depending on the issue's nature.
